      This collection features a blend of previously published stories and new tales, showcasing Anderson's signature wit and warmth. The rich characters navigate diverse settings, spanning from mid-20th century rural New Zealand to modern-day hair salons, offering a tapestry of experiences across various locations and time periods.

      Set against the backdrop of the Gospels, the narrative centers on Joanna, a wealthy woman from Herod Agrippa's court, who defies societal norms to support Jesus. As a trained midwife, she allies with Mary Magdalene and Susanna, engaging in acts of solidarity and sacrifice. Their journey explores themes of faith, empowerment, and resilience as they strive to spread Jesus' message following his crucifixion and resurrection, highlighting the often-overlooked roles of women in early Christianity.

    • It's 1936, New Zealand. Lorna's spending the summer at the beach with her three children, but she's bored and only sees her husband at the weekends. When the handsome James gets the locals and the Maoris involved in his amateur western, Lust in the Dust, Lorna is briefly consumed by lust for James and old certainties fall away as unaccustomed proximity leads to unexpected liaisons

      The autobiography offers a profound exploration of the author's journey through childhood, motherhood, and her role as the wife of a naval officer. It captures her late-life return to education and rekindled passion for writing. Spanning 80 years, the narrative not only reflects her personal experiences but also serves as a lens into the broader history of New Zealand, highlighting the interplay between individual and national identity.

      Set against the backdrop of Philadelphia and Louisiana, the story follows Catherine Pennington, affectionately known as Billie. Her childhood experiences, including a pivotal trip to Louisiana at age seven, introduce her to Weiss, the privileged son of a German family, and Royce, the son of a black maid. This encounter deepens her affection for Louisiana and explores themes of class, race, and the complexities of love and friendship.
